Circle Partners with Grab to Start Web3 Wallet in Singapore

Reading Time: < 1 minute

Web3 has been getting the attention of many organizations as multiple firms dive into it. Recently Circle Internet Financial has shown its interest in Web3 and taken great steps in working within it. Circle which is in charge of issuing USDC stablecoin has made its intention known to the public on the interest to collaborate with Grab. The aim of it all is to improve the Web3 experience in Singapore.

According to tweets that Circle shared on X ‘Twitter’ the combination between Circle’s Web3 Service and Grab app could create Grab Web3 Wallet. Thus enabling crypto users to build wallets that can utilize the blockchain by using this new Web3 API. Although Grab Web3 wallets are still in their development stages will be able to approve the SG Pitstop Pack NFT vouchers. Users can also earn massive rewards from the wallet and hold NFTs.

Here is was he stated:

“Piloting our technology with Grab’s customers brings us closer to realizing the full potential of responsible digital assets innovation.”

He was then seconded by the Head of Global Policy at Circle, Dante Disparate, who endorsed this project of collaboration and said that it was a great way of speeding up and empowering blockchain more in Singapore. This innovative move from both parties will help crypto enthusiasts in Singapore to dive more into digital assets.
